To register to vote in Lacon, Illinois, residents can register online through the Illinois State Board of Elections's website, by mail, or in person at the Marshall County elections office. Illinois requires voters to be U.S. Citizens, at least 18 years old by Election Day, and residents of the state. The registration deadline is typically 30 days before an election. Voters can verify their registration status and find polling locations through the Illinois State Board of Elections's voter lookup tool. For local municipal elections in Lacon, contact the Marshall County Clerk's office for schedules and ballot information.
Vital records for Lacon, Illinois, including birth, death, and marriage certificates, are kept by the Marshall County Clerk's Office. This office is responsible for maintaining these important records and can be contacted at https://www.marshallcountyil.com/departments/county-clerk for more information. Residents can also access vital record services through the Illinois Department of Public Health website at https://www.dph.illinois.gov/topics-services/birth-death-other-records.
